Nowadays, products renewal speed and user demand diversity is the trend of the development. The question is the products diversity、 personality、 small-lot manufacturing and short time of maintenance. So, the measures of modular、 parameter design and computer aided design must be taken.The research object of this paper is NC horizontal lathe. It has developed a set of Computer Aided Combination system based on the research of home and abroad. The system uses Visual Basic as programming language and SolidWorks as a platform.In the research and development process, it has compiled a DLL files with VB6.0by the supported of SolidWorks API. The modules can be automatic selection and combination by standardized NC horizontal lathe template. It greatly improves the design efficiency and shortened the design cycle.In whole study, the NC horizontal lathe’s function model and system structure were designed based on modular product design theory. It put forward the module coding method based on group technology and completion of the main modules coding system of machine tool. The second development of SolidWorks has been explored and it established a detail progress about Computer Aided Combination. It analysised a data management of machine tool’s module about production management、 sales management and warehouse management. The system model has been established with Rational Rose based on UML.At last, it wrote system program and designed man-computer interface.
